Amazon.com Book Description (ISBN 1590591313, Paperback)

While many books are focused on the underlying technologies of Web Services and others are dedicated to providing Web Services, few books show how to consume Web Services. This new book, Google, Amazon and Beyond: Creating and Consuming Web Services, provides a thorough review of the technologies and techniques for connecting client applications to services of all kinds. Using a decidedly hands-on approach, the authors show extensive examples of programming with XML, SOAP, WSDL, and UDDI in a variety of programming languages.

Technology involved: Java, Perl, XML, XSLT, WSDL, SOAP, XML-RPC, UDDI, JavaScript, .NET, JSP, RSS.
